Transaction 08caec7ea595ff5f63dc421f064c64fe435ae313c95ddf7152a069fb1545f976

1 Input
1 Outputs
  • 08caec7ea595ff5f63dc421f064c64fe435ae313c95ddf7152a069fb1545f976:0
  • value  32149469
    address  bc1qhte39nwltgvuert4ssz2t49p4ltmnfcy3m4qp4